Khanu - Ratnagiri

Khanu is a village situated in the Ratnagiri tehsil of Ratnagiri district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 25 km from Ratnagiri, which serves as both the tehsil and district headquarters. Khanu village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Khanu is 565614. The village covers a total geographical area of 992 hectares and falls under the 415803 pincode. Ratnagiri is the nearest town, located about 25 km away.

Khanu village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Ratnagiri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Ratnagiri - Sindhudurg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Khanu

As per Census 2011, Khanu village has a total population of 1,866 people, consisting of 902 males and 964 females. The village has 422 households and a sex ratio of 1,068 females per 1,000 males. There are 150 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,434 literate and 432 illiterate residents. Additionally, 307 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Khanu

Khanu is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Nivasar, while the nearest airport is Kolhapur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 69.1 km.
